The Vatican Museum - well a minuscule part of it anyway. Definitely makes you wonder how the 'church' collected all the pieces. Whilst listening to the audio tape the narrator kept saying that "they just happen to stumble upon them". A beautiful museum regardless. The Sistine Chapel was without doubt the highlight.

Part of the Gallery of Maps.  This map shows the east coast of Italy, the Adriatic Sea and the Italian ruled Croatian coast.  Of most importance(!) is the Croatian city of Zada (Zadar)which is the city my parents are from - well a little village just outside.  Zadar still has many Romanesque buildings and ruins.
